

Oracle CX Sales and Bitrix24 compete in the CRM market. Bitrix24 has an edge through cost-effectiveness and diverse features, while Oracle CX Sales offers robust support and advanced functionalities for larger enterprises.
Features: Oracle CX Sales is noted for its advanced analytics, CRM automation, and seamless integration with Oracle products, making it ideal for large-scale operations. Bitrix24 provides extensive collaboration tools, customizable workflows, and built-in telephony, suitable for small to medium-sized businesses.
Room for Improvement: Oracle CX Sales could simplify its setup process, enhance user interface customization, and reduce initial costs. Bitrix24 needs to improve its marketing strategies, increase popularity in the market, and expand integration capabilities with third-party solutions.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Bitrix24's cloud deployment is straightforward, and its responsive customer support is valued. Oracle CX Sales, requiring a more intricate setup, benefits enterprises with IT resources, but its customer service is detailed and professional.
Pricing and ROI: Bitrix24 offers competitive pricing with a free tier and scalable plans providing quick ROI for cost-conscious businesses. Oracle CX Sales, while initially higher in cost, provides significant long-term ROI through enhanced functionalities and detailed analytics.

Bitrix24 is a highly customizable platform offering tools for CRM, project management, and team collaboration. Its features are tailored for organizations seeking stable solutions with integration capabilities. Despite challenges, it remains a popular choice for managing enterprise-wide tasks.
Bitrix24 provides an array of functionalities designed to streamline business operations. It includes project management, CRM integration, and collaboration tools. Users appreciate its capabilities in data entry, automation, and pipeline views, along with third-party integrations. While it excels in team collaboration and office automation, there are some aspects like marketing automation and financial workflows that could be improved. Users find challenges with integration capabilities, especially with ERP systems, and experience performance issues and bugs in mobile systems. There is a need for better support services, and extracting data can be problematic.

Oracle CX Sales offers mobile-enabled lead and opportunity management, integrating seamlessly with sales processes. It provides robust analytics and intuitive access to customer data, ensuring efficiency for sales reps and managers.
Oracle CX Sales is a comprehensive platform designed to streamline sales and customer management processes. With tools for handling leads, opportunities, and data management, it enhances workflow efficiency through customizable and industry-specific features. Integrating across marketing and post-sales phases, Oracle CX Sales ensures seamless data flow, supported by a stable system architecture. Sales teams have intuitive access to projects and reports through an easy-to-use interface, allowing them to manage customer orders, track sales calls, and handle online campaigns efficiently.
